Frequently asked questions

What is the name of Fort Payne's airport?
Most people like to fly into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ta Intl. Airport (ATL) when visiting Fort Payne. However, there is more than one airport in the region, so keep that in mind when organising your itinerary.
How many airlines fly to Fort Payne?
Fort Payne is serviced by 22 airlines from at least 197 airports across the globe.
Which airlines fly to Fort Payne?
Delta Air Lines, American Airlines and Spirit Airlines are the most frequent fliers to Fort Payne. The majority of flights come in from Dallas, with Delta Air Lines offering the most services on this route.
How many nonstop flights are there to Fort Payne?
Flying to someplace new is much simpler when there aren’t any stopovers involved. If you’re off to Fort Payne, the awesome news is that there are 6,732 nonstop flights operating each week.
Where are the most popular flights to Fort Payne departing from?
Travellers frequently depart from Dallas, Houston and Chicago airports when going to Fort Payne.
How long is the flight to Fort Payne Airport?
If it’s Washington you’re leaving behind, you’ll be midair for around 2 hours and 4 minutes before you arrive in Fort Payne. Airport to airport from Dallas takes approximately 1 hour and 58 minutes and from Chicago, it’s 1 hour and 53 minutes.

How to survive the flight to Fort Payne?
Depending on where you’re coming from, your trip to Fort Payne could be no sweat at all or it could drag on forever. We’ve rounded up some useful hints that will help you start your unforgettable escape on the right foot.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• Flying can be a great experience if you bring the right stuff. Firstly, you’ll want some basic toiletries, such as a toothbrush and lip balm, a spare set of clothes and a good read. Secondly, make room in your bag for your phone and charger, any medications and maybe a cosy neck pillow as well. Lastly, be sure to take your passport, travel docs and some cash.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Squeeze all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and hairspray in your checked luggage. Any liquids in your carry-on bag lar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by security. Sharp or pointed objects, like your precious pocket knife, and dangerous products which are explosive or flammable, such as flares, chemicals agents and gasoline, are also prohibited.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The long, narrow aisles of an aircraft are not the best place for a fashion parade. Wear comfortable clothes and don’t forget to bring a sweater as it can get chilly in the cabin. Flat, enclosed shoes are also a good choice.
  • Unfortunately, one risk of long flights is developing de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clotting condition caused by prolonged inactivity. To prevent this from happening, make the most of every opportunity to walk around and give your legs a stretch. Compression socks and tights are another simple way to help minimize this risk.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Fort Payne?
Being organised before you get to the airport can make your trip to Fort Payne a breeze. Read through our useful tips and tricks for a swift journey past security:

  • Your passport and boarding pass will need to be shown to security personnel. Have them close by so you don’t hold up the line.
  • The X-ray machine is up next. Empty your pockets and remove anything metal that is likely to beep. This includes things like headphones or earphones, as well as heavy coats or jackets. They’ll need to be placed on the conveyor belt for screening.
  • For just a few moments, you’ll need to unplug from technology. Your laptop, phone and any other electronic devices must also go through the scanner.
  • Remove all liquids and gels from your carry-on luggage. They often need to be sent through the X-ray scanner separately. Each product should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• Choosing your footwear wisely can save you several valuable minutes. Hiking boots are often required to be removed and separately scanned. Lightweight sneakers are usually not.
  • Airlines will not allow any pocket knives or other sharp items in the cabin.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them safely in your checked luggage.
